The Kitty KONG is a toy and treat dispenser designed specifically to tap into the natural curiosity and hunting instincts of your cat Squeeze a little of the KONG Easy Treat into the KONG for your cat to enjoy. You can also use a pinch of catnip or your cat’s favorite dry kibble inside this versatile toy.

Lick Mats: Do cats like lick mats

LickiMats are preferred by most if not all cats to a traditional feeding bowl as they eliminate any whisker stress caused by contact with the sides of a traditional feeding bowl. LickiMats also give the cat the all-round vision that they prefer.

How much peanut butter can a cat have?


Cat:

A cat should eat no more than half a tablespoon of peanut butter twice a week 90% of calories for cats should come from specially formulated foods. That leaves only 10% of calories that can come from treats. If, for example, your cat needs 250 calories per day, only 25 calories should come from treats.

How do you buy a harness for a cat?


Harness:

You want the harness to be snug, but not too tight You want your cat to be able to walk comfortably with no movement restriction, but you also don’t want her to be able to wriggle out of the harness. As a general rule, you should be able to fit a finger or two, but not more than that, under the harness.

Butter Ok: Is butter OK for cats to eat

Is Butter Bad for Your Pet? While butter isn’t toxic to pets, it can cause issues including mild vomiting or diarrhea , according to the Pet Poison Helpline (PPH). This is true of all fatty foods, including oils and grease.

Plain Yogurt Good: Is plain yogurt good for cats

So remember, nonfat plain yogurt is usually safe and healthy for cats and dogs to eat as a fun snack , just check the nutrition label first to make sure it doesn’t contain a dangerous ingredient, like xylitol. Can cats eat carrots?


Carrots:

Yes, your cat can eat carrots as long as they are cooked to a soft texture and without any added seasonings Raw carrots or carrots cooked with added flavoring can cause digestive issues.
